Libro Del renacuajo a la rana

How does a frog grow? Beginning as a tiny egg and then a tadpole, a frog stays mostly in the water until it is fully grown.

Animales En Peligro: Un Mundo de Especies Amenazadas

Libro Animales En Peligro: Un Mundo de Especies Amenazadas

Deforestation, hunting and global warming have endangered countless species. The orangutan, okapi, giant panda and the blue whale are just some of the 30 species on the brink of extinction that are featured in this book. They need your help. The International Conservation Society illustrates how many of these species are left in the wild, and the latest status regarding their natural environment. You'll learn how you can aid endangered species and help sustain the ecosystems that give them life.
